  • In this paper, we discussed an effective VDSL frequency plan for symmetric 10MDSL service. The frequency plan 998 and plan 997 for asymmetric VDSL services have been not optimally designed for 10MDSL services. To obtain the reaches and data rates of 10MDSL, we proposed two frequency allocation schemes : Static method and dynamic method. We can select frequency bands with their fixed boundaries in static method while with their variable boundaries in dynamic method. To show the effectiveness of our proposed methods, we performed some simulations about plan 997 and plan 998, new static method, and new dynamic method. According to the simulation results, the proposed dynamic method can provide the best data rates and reaches for 10 Mbps symmetric VDSL services.

  • The Saemangeum master plan includes dredging and waterproofing materials, construction projects that can change the hydraulic characteristics of the Saemangeum and Mangyeong and Dongjin River basins. In this study, the river safety of 2030 when the Saemangeum master plan was completed for 100 year frequency, 500 year frequency and 100 year frequency applied RCP 8.5 scenario was examined using Delft3D. As a result of the analysis, it was confirmed that there was no overflowing point at the 100 year frequency, but the difference between the flood level and the river bank elevation was relatively small at the curved and river joint part. At the 100-year frequency with the 500-year frequency and the RCP 8.5 scenario, the possibility of overflowing at several locations was confirmed. The possibility of river bed loss due to fast velocity appears in the upstream part of Mankyung River and it is necessary to monitor the safety of hydraulic structures continuously. In addition, it is expected that the expansion of the area showing the characteristics of the lake due to dredging will affect the sediment mechanism and water quality, so detailed and diverse studies will be needed.

  • A problem of frequency in the field of low-frequencies such as high-rise apartment building or construction vibration are often found. In this study, damage reason of a 25 stories apartment building was searched on the basis of actual damage. To find the damage reason, structural design procedure were reviewed and low-frequency vibration test was conducted. The results indicate that the main damage reason is not by the low-frequency vibration but the asymmetrical plan of that building.

  • There is a growing interest in establishing a regional climate change adaptation policy as the climate change impact in the region and local scale increases. This study focused on the analysis of 32 regions on its characteristics of local climate change adaptation plans. First, statistic program R was used for conducting cluster analysis based on the frequency and budgets of adaptation plan. Further, we analyzed damage frequency from newspapers regarding climate change impacts in eight categories which were caused by extreme weather events on 2,565 cases for 24 years. Lastly, the characteristics of climate change adaptation plan was compared with damage frequency patterns for evaluating the adequacy of climate change adaptation plan on each cluster. Four different clusters were created by cluster analysis. Most clusters clearly have their own characteristics on certain sectors. There was a high frequency of damage in 'disaster' and 'health' sectors. Climate change adaptation plan and budget also invested a lot on those sectors. However, when comparing the relative rate among regional governments, there was a difference between types of damage and climate change adaptation plan. We assumed that the difference could come from that each region established their adaptation plans based on not only the frequency of damage, but vulnerability assessment, and expert opinions as well. The result of study could contribute to policy making of climate change adaptation plan.
